Things to remember when driving Securing cargo > Use the luggage net* or securing straps to hold down small and lightweight luggage and cargo. > Heavy-duty cargo straps* for securing larger and heavier objects are available at your BMW center. Four lashing eyes mounted in the cargo bay are used to secure these heavy-duty cargo straps, refer to illustration. > Please observe the special instructions supplied with the heavy-duty cargo straps. Position and secure the cargo as described above, so that it cannot endanger the vehicle's occupants, for example if sudden braking or evasive maneuvers are necessary. Never exceed either the approved gross vehicle weight or either of the approved axle loads, refer to page 245, as excessive loads can pose a safety hazard, and may also place you in violation of traffic safety laws. You should never transport unsecured heavy or hard objects in the passenger compartment, as they could fly around and pose a safety hazard to the vehicle's occupants during abrupt braking or evasive maneuvers. Use only the lashing eyes pictured to fasten the heavy-duty cargo straps. Do not secure cargo with the upper attachment points for LATCH, refer to page 59; otherwise, you could damage them.< Pad on base of luggage compartment You can use the pad as needed, for example to transport soiled objects. The rubberized side is washable and has an anti-skid effect. 130 Online Edition for Part no. 01 41 2 600 759 - © 08/08 BMW AG
